7eb726d57f
The old implementation used the default ld.script for the kernel side which did not obey the memory.ld limits whatsoever. Also, provide the user space addresses from the linker script to get rid of the pre-processor macros that define (incorrect) default values for the user space composition.
82 lines
2.1 KiB
Plaintext
82 lines
2.1 KiB
Plaintext
#
|
|
# This file is autogenerated: PLEASE DO NOT EDIT IT.
|
|
#
|
|
# You can use "make menuconfig" to make any modifications to the installed .config file.
|
|
# You can then do "make savedefconfig" to generate a new defconfig file that includes your
|
|
# modifications.
|
|
#
|
|
# CONFIG_DISABLE_OS_API is not set
|
|
# CONFIG_NSH_DISABLE_LOSMART is not set
|
|
CONFIG_ARCH="risc-v"
|
|
CONFIG_ARCH_BOARD="icicle"
|
|
CONFIG_ARCH_BOARD_ICICLE_MPFS=y
|
|
CONFIG_ARCH_CHIP="mpfs"
|
|
CONFIG_ARCH_CHIP_MPFS250T_FCVG484=y
|
|
CONFIG_ARCH_CHIP_MPFS=y
|
|
CONFIG_ARCH_INTERRUPTSTACK=2048
|
|
CONFIG_ARCH_RISCV=y
|
|
CONFIG_ARCH_STACKDUMP=y
|
|
CONFIG_ARCH_USE_MPU=y
|
|
CONFIG_BOARD_LOOPSPERMSEC=54000
|
|
CONFIG_BUILD_PROTECTED=y
|
|
CONFIG_BUILTIN=y
|
|
CONFIG_DEBUG_ASSERTIONS=y
|
|
CONFIG_DEBUG_ERROR=y
|
|
CONFIG_DEBUG_FEATURES=y
|
|
CONFIG_DEBUG_FULLOPT=y
|
|
CONFIG_DEBUG_INFO=y
|
|
CONFIG_DEBUG_SYMBOLS=y
|
|
CONFIG_DEBUG_WARN=y
|
|
CONFIG_DEV_ZERO=y
|
|
CONFIG_EXPERIMENTAL=y
|
|
CONFIG_FS_PROCFS=y
|
|
CONFIG_FS_ROMFS=y
|
|
CONFIG_IDLETHREAD_STACKSIZE=2048
|
|
CONFIG_INIT_ENTRYPOINT="nsh_main"
|
|
CONFIG_INIT_STACKSIZE=3072
|
|
CONFIG_INTELHEX_BINARY=y
|
|
CONFIG_LIBC_FLOATINGPOINT=y
|
|
CONFIG_LIBC_HOSTNAME="icicle"
|
|
CONFIG_LIBC_PERROR_STDOUT=y
|
|
CONFIG_LIBC_STRERROR=y
|
|
CONFIG_MEMSET_64BIT=y
|
|
CONFIG_MEMSET_OPTSPEED=y
|
|
CONFIG_MPFS_ENABLE_DPFPU=y
|
|
CONFIG_MPFS_UART1=y
|
|
CONFIG_NSH_ARCHINIT=y
|
|
CONFIG_NSH_BUILTIN_APPS=y
|
|
CONFIG_NSH_DISABLE_IFUPDOWN=y
|
|
CONFIG_NSH_DISABLE_MKDIR=y
|
|
CONFIG_NSH_DISABLE_RM=y
|
|
CONFIG_NSH_DISABLE_RMDIR=y
|
|
CONFIG_NSH_DISABLE_UMOUNT=y
|
|
CONFIG_NSH_LINELEN=160
|
|
CONFIG_NSH_STRERROR=y
|
|
CONFIG_NUTTX_USERSPACE=0x80040000
|
|
CONFIG_PASS1_BUILDIR="boards/risc-v/mpfs/common/kernel"
|
|
CONFIG_PREALLOC_TIMERS=4
|
|
CONFIG_RAM_SIZE=262144
|
|
CONFIG_RAM_START=0x80080000
|
|
CONFIG_RAW_BINARY=y
|
|
CONFIG_READLINE_CMD_HISTORY=y
|
|
CONFIG_READLINE_TABCOMPLETION=y
|
|
CONFIG_RR_INTERVAL=200
|
|
CONFIG_SCHED_HPWORK=y
|
|
CONFIG_SCHED_LPWORK=y
|
|
CONFIG_SCHED_WAITPID=y
|
|
CONFIG_SERIAL_NPOLLWAITERS=2
|
|
CONFIG_STACK_COLORATION=y
|
|
CONFIG_START_MONTH=4
|
|
CONFIG_START_YEAR=2021
|
|
CONFIG_SYSLOG_COLOR_OUTPUT=y
|
|
CONFIG_SYSTEM_CLE_CMD_HISTORY=y
|
|
CONFIG_SYSTEM_COLOR_CLE=y
|
|
CONFIG_SYSTEM_NSH=y
|
|
CONFIG_SYSTEM_TIME64=y
|
|
CONFIG_SYS_RESERVED=9
|
|
CONFIG_TASK_NAME_SIZE=20
|
|
CONFIG_TESTING_GETPRIME=y
|
|
CONFIG_TESTING_OSTEST=y
|
|
CONFIG_TESTING_OSTEST_FPUSIZE=264
|
|
CONFIG_UART1_SERIAL_CONSOLE=y
|